I am unaware of Oregon State ever being a preseason #1. The Beavers were a unanimous top 10 team in 2017, but TCU was the unanimous #1. Oregon State was fifth in the Collegiate Baseball poll, but that was the Beavers' best ranking, I think. TCU lost in the semifinal in 2015 to eventual runner-up Vanderbilt and in 2016 to the eventual champion Coastal Carolina. The Frogs and returned eight of nine starters, all three starting pitchers, and their closer. And their best player was freshman Nick Lodolo, who came on after Mitchell Traver was injured at the end of February.
TCU finished as the #6 National Seed and lost to Florida in the semifinal opposite Oregon State in 2017.
After playing and losing in three consecutive national semifinals, TCU missed the 2018 postseason and did not escape a Regional in 2019, 2021, or 2022.
